Job summary
Micron Technology in Boise, Idaho is seeking an MTS Design Verification Engineer to lead DRAM verification for next‑generation memory products. You will shape verification strategy, guide methodologies, and collaborate with global teams to deliver high‑quality, scalable solutions. The role requires 8+ years in DRAM or CMOS verification, strong transistor‑level debugging, and experience with Verilog/SystemVerilog and HSPICE. Advanced degree and Python skills with AI-assisted tools are a plus.
Qualifications
Bachelor’s degree in Electrical Engineering, Computer Engineering, or related field.
8+ years of experience in DRAM/memory or advanced CMOS verification.
Strong circuit analysis and debugging at the transistor level.
Responsibilities
Lead DRAM verification innovation, driving key technical decisions, architecture, and strategy during product execution.
Collaborate with global teams to define and implement best-known methods for verification and product development.
Drive verification planning, coverage closure, and silicon debugging for advanced DRAM products.
Evaluate and implement new tools, methodologies, and flows to improve verification efficiency and quality.
Mentor engineers and provide technical leadership while contributing expert guidance to senior leadership teams.
